"This Autumn easy reversible quilted table runner pattern is perfect for beginning sewers, and it can be completed in just a few hours. Plus, you can make it in any size you like. This is a great holiday quilt pattern to make in a weekend too. Measuring 12” x 34”, this quilt is the perfect size to decorate a table. There’s nothing like a handmade table runner to add a touch of personality to your dining room furniture. With just a few simple steps, you can create a table runner that will complement any color scheme or style."

Materials List

  • Backing fabric is a solid piece of fabric cut slightly larger than the top. 14 inches wide X 36 inches long. I used Winter Deer in the Woods Christmas Cotton Fabric.
  • Quilt top fabrics uses 4 rectangles trimmed to 7 ½ inches wide X 12 ½ inches long. I used Autumn Herbalism Navi Cotton Fabric. Between the 4 rectangles I used three strips of the jelly roll Autumn Hues 40-Piece Cotton Fabric Roll 2 ½ X 7 ½ inches.
  • Binding fabric consists of 3 pieces of the jelly roll strips sewn together. You will need approximately 100 inches long X 2 ½ inches wide of binding fabric.
  • You’ll need a piece of 14” x 36” thin cotton batting like Warm & Natural to make this quilt.
